What Are Robot Vacuums and Mops?

Robot vacuums and mops are autonomous cleaning gadgets created to carry out standard cleaning jobs such as vacuuming and mopping floors. These robotics utilize innovative sensors, algorithms, and mapping innovation to navigate your home, clean successfully, and return to their charging stations when the battery is low. They are particularly beneficial for families with pets, allergies, or hectic schedules, as they can run regularly and effectively without human intervention.

Secret Features of Robot Vacuums and Mops

  1. Autonomous Navigation

    • Sensing units and Mapping: Most robot vacuums and mops use a combination of sensors, including infrared, ultrasonic, and visual sensors, to map and browse the environment. They can discover challenges, prevent falls, and even acknowledge particular rooms.
    • Smart Apps and Voice Control: Many models include smartphone apps that permit users to arrange cleaning, monitor progress, and manage the robot vacuum cleaners uk remotely. Some are likewise suitable with voice ass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.
  2. Cleaning Capabilities

    • Vacuuming: Robot vacuums are geared up with different suction levels to manage various kinds of floorings, from wood to carpets. They can get rid of dust, dirt, and small particles.
    • Mopping: Robot mops utilize water tanks and microfiber mopping pads to clean and polish tough floorings. Some designs can change in between vacuuming and mopping modes automatically.
  3. Battery Life

    • Lasting Batteries: Modern robot vacuums and mops come with lasting lithium-ion batteries that can run for 60 to 120 minutes on a single charge.
    • Automatic Recharging: When the battery is low, the robot can autonomously go back to its charging station and resume cleaning as soon as completely charged.
  4. Upkeep and Upkeep

    • Easy to Clean: Most designs have easily detachable and washable filters, dustbins, and mopping pads.
    • Routine Maintenance: Users ought to carry out routine maintenance, such as clearing the dustbin, cleaning the brushes, and changing filters, to make sure optimum performance.

Potential Drawbacks

  1. Expense

    • Preliminary Investment: Robot vacuums and mops can be more pricey than conventional cleaning tools. Nevertheless, the long-lasting advantages and benefit frequently justify the expense.
  2. Restricted Cleaning Power

    • Suction Strength: While they are effective for day-to-day upkeep, robot vacuums might not have the exact same suction power as full-sized vacuum, making them less suitable for deep cleaning big messes.
    • Water Capacity: Robot mops typically have smaller water tanks, which might require more frequent refills for larger homes.
  3. Maintenance Requirements

    robot-vacuum-mops-logo-text-black-png-original.jpg
    • Routine Cleaning: To ensure ideal efficiency, users should routinely clean and preserve the robot, which can be a minor hassle.
    • Filter and Pad Replacement: Filters and mopping pads require to be replaced periodically, adding to the ongoing expense.
  4. Navigation Limitations

    • Obstacle Detection: While advanced, the sensors and mapping technology can in some cases fight with uncommon obstacles or pet hair.
    • Space Coverage: In some cases, the robot may not cover every inch of a space, particularly if there are many obstacles or high-traffic areas.

FAQs

Q1: How do I establish a robot vacuum and mop?

  • Answer: Most robot vacuums and mops come with user handbooks and quick setup guides. Typically, you require to charge the robot, connect it to your Wi-Fi network, and utilize the smart device app to set up schedules and cleaning zones.

Q2: Can robot vacuums and mops clean stairs?

  • Response: No, most robot vacuums and mops are not created to clean stairs. They are equipped with sensing units to identify and prevent falls, making them safe but not efficient in climbing stairs.

Q3: Are robot vacuums and mops loud?

  • Response: While they can produce some sound, modern-day models are developed to be reasonably quiet, often running below 60 decibels. You can schedule their cleaning during quieter times of the day to reduce disruption.

Q4: How often should I clean the robot?

  • Answer: It is recommended to empty the dustbin and tidy the brushes after each use. Filters must be cleaned weekly, and mopping pads must be washed after each mopping session.
